Description:
BEZ 235, with the CAS number 915019-65-7, is a small molecule that functions primarily as a dual inhibitor of the phosphoinositide 3-kinase (PI3K) and mammalian target of rapamycin (mTOR) pathways. These pathways are crucial in regulating cell growth, proliferation, and survival, making BEZ 235 of interest in cancer research and treatment. The compound exhibits a specific structure that allows it to effectively bind to the active sites of the targeted kinases, thereby inhibiting their activity. This inhibition can lead to reduced tumor growth and enhanced apoptosis in cancer cells. BEZ 235 has been studied in various preclinical and clinical settings, particularly for its potential efficacy against certain types of tumors that exhibit aberrant activation of the PI3K/mTOR signaling pathway. Additionally, its pharmacokinetic properties, including absorption, distribution, metabolism, and excretion, are important for determining its therapeutic potential and safety profile in clinical applications.
